Explore the intersection of LEGO, play and architecture with LEGO Masters Season 4 Contestant Ben Edlavitch. Learn about architecture and its impact on the surrounding landscape.
Collaborate to build a miniature city skyline while learning valuable tips and tricks for building with LEGO, insights from LEGO designers in Denmark, and the experiences of contestants on LEGO Masters FOX. Registration begins 2 weeks before each program.

Ettrick-Matoaca Library serves the communities of Matoaca and Ettrick. It is situated on the outskirts of Virginia State University's Randolph Farm just down the road from the bustling Village of Ettrick. In 2013, the Ettrick-Matoaca Library was completely renovated as a better, brighter, more functional public space. It has one of several reading gardens located at libraries. Thanks to a gift from a local organization, the Ettrick-Matoaca Library is home to a makerspace that includes a 3-D printer, two sewing machines and raised garden beds for a community garden.
